Weekly challenge: Write a 500 word minimum post on etiquette in your world (or a part of your world) and post it on the forum with a link. You can go as in-depth or not as you like, as long as you meet the word count. It can address any or many form(s) of etiquette, such as how to greet someone, how to behave at the table, etc.
